Output 0152ee359afeb739c95b288af9e385eca16c30bd1b9bd9ff96650efda4eb6600:0

value
14850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12047953383e0b998cd0b21b288227e44fa9c872b70024cf6f8995ca8bb1b3e
address
tb1puysy09fns0stnxxdpvsm9zpz0ez048y89dcqyn8klzv4e29mrvlq6whhgk
transaction
0152ee359afeb739c95b288af9e385eca16c30bd1b9bd9ff96650efda4eb6600
confirmations
40603
spent
true